Bergamasco Sheepdog versus Papipoo: Overview

A very important difference between the Bergamasco Sheepdog and the Papipoo is the size difference between the two dog breeds. The Bergamasco Sheepdog is a medium-sized dog while the Papipoo is a tiny-sized dog.

Furthermore, the Bergamasco Sheepdog belongs to the Herding Dogs group. Herding Dogs were bred for moving livestock, including sheep, cattle, and even reindeer. Herding dogs work closely with their human shepherds, and their natural intelligence and responsiveness make them highly trainable. They have high levels of energy, which needs to be channeled properly to prevent destructive behavior. Herding breeds are protective of their people and property and make excellent watchdogs. Their intelligence, agility, and activity level make them well suited to dog sports.

On the other hand, the Papipoo belongs to the Mixed Breed Dogs group. Mixed Breed Dogs are not purebred dogs.

    Size Comparison of Bergamasco Sheepdog versus Papipoo

    Now, let us discuss the difference in size between the Bergamasco Sheepdog and the Papipoo.

    Bergamasco Sheepdogs weigh 55 to 85 pounds when fully grown. Bergamasco Sheepdogs are 20 to 24 inches when fully grown.

    On the other hand, Papipoos weigh 6 to 14 pounds when fully grown. Papipoos are 10 to 11 inches when fully grown.

    Lifespan of Bergamasco Sheepdog versus Papipoo

    The lifespan of Bergamasco Sheepdogs is between 13 to 15 years. The average lifespan of Bergamasco Sheepdogs is 14.0 years.

    The lifespan of Papipoos is between 10 to 14 years. The average lifespan of Papipoos is 12.0 years.

    Bergamasco Sheepdogs live longer than Papipoos.
